Countertops and Backsplashes questions, answered by experts

You can put hot pans on porcelain countertops. Porcelain is highly resistant to heat—it’s manufactured at around 2,500 degrees Fahrenheit, so it can withstand a ton of heat without cracking or damaging. Even though the high heat is a plus, you should still be cautious when putting hot surfaces on porcelain countertops.

Epoxy is the best sealer for concrete countertops. It fills in gaps, rough areas, and imperfections for a smooth finish and will usually last the life of the concrete. Other options include acrylic and polyurethane sealers, which protect the countertops from stains but must be reapplied every few years to maintain proper surface protection.

Countertop overlays can be a worthwhile investment for homeowners looking for an affordable and fuss-free way to update their kitchens without a full replacement. The installation process is budget-friendly, saves time and labor, and can often be completed in a single day as it doesn't require demolition. Overlays are installed directly over the pre-existing countertop, with material options including quartz, granite, and recycled glass. However, for the overlay to be long-lasting, it is crucial that the underlying surface is properly prepped to ensure strong adhesion.
